Leg injury leaves Villanova's Justin Moore in tears as Wildcats clinch Final Four berth

Villanova is headed to the Final Four.

But its celebration was dampened by an injury to Justin Moore. The Wildcats' All-Big East guard fell to the floor with a non-contact leg injury late in Saturday's Elite Eight win over Houston. He sustained the injury on a drive to the basket in the game's final minute with Villanova leading 48-44.

He planted his right leg and immediately collapsed before a jump ball was called amid a tie-up.

He grabbed his lower right leg as soon as he fell. He eventually limped off the court with the help of his teammates, but clearly struggled to put weight on his injured leg.
